Huntley 'had breakdown after arrest'

Ian Huntley had a nervous breakdown in the months after being arrested on suspicion of the murders of Holly Wells and Jessica Chapman, the Old Bailey heard today.

Huntley underwent a series of mental “shutdowns” which could last for up to two hours and he could do nothing about it, the jury heard.
